What is a Robot Vacuum Mopper?
A robot vacuum mopper, also referred to as a top robotic vacuums for pet hair cleanup mop or a combined vacuum and mop, is an autonomous cleaning gadget developed to both vacuum and mop floorings. These robots are geared up with sophisticated sensing units and navigation systems that permit them to map and clean your home effectively. They can deal with various floor types, including hardwood, tile, and carpet, and are particularly beneficial in homes that require frequent cleaning due to pets, kids, or high foot traffic.
Key Features of Robot Vacuum Moppers
Double Functionality: Unlike conventional robot vacuums, which just get dust and debris, robot vacuum moppers can also clean and mop floors. This dual functionality conserves time and effort, as you no longer requirement to utilize different gadgets for vacuuming and mopping.

Advanced Navigation Systems: Modern robot vacuum moppers are equipped with advanced navigation systems, such as L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) and VSLAM (Visual Simultaneous Localization and Mapping). These innovations allow the robot to produce an in-depth map of your home, browse around obstacles, and clean systematically.

Water Management System: The water management system is a vital function that makes sure the floor is mopped without being over-soaked. These systems can control the quantity of water released, change to different floor types, and even dry the floor after mopping.

Personalized Cleaning Schedules: Users can set up cleaning schedules through a mobile app or voice commands, making sure that their floorings are cleaned routinely without the requirement for manual intervention.

Numerous Cleaning Modes: Robot vacuum moppers provide numerous cleaning modes, such as area cleaning, edge cleaning, and deep cleaning, to deal with various needs and floor conditions.

Compatibility with Smart Home Ecosystems: Many robot vacuum moppers can be incorporated with smart home systems like Amazon Alexa and Google Home, permitting smooth control and automation.

High-Capacity Batteries: Advanced designs include high-capacity batteries, supplying numerous hours of cleaning time on a single charge. They also return to their charging dock immediately when the battery is low.

User-Friendly Design: Most robot vacuum moppers are developed with user benefit in mind. They are easy to establish, operate, and keep, making them available to a large range of users.

Factors to consider Before Buying a Robot Vacuum Mopper
Floor Type Compatibility: Ensure that the robot vacuum mopper you pick is suitable for your floor type. Some models are much better matched for tough floorings, while others can handle carpets as well.

Challenge Detection: Look for models with advanced obstacle detection abilities to avoid damage to furnishings and other items in your house.

Water Tank Capacity: A larger water tank means more extended mopping sessions, decreasing the need for refills. However, it likewise increases the weight of the device.

Battery Life: A longer battery life allows the robot to clean up more extensive locations without needing to charge. Consider models that offer at least 1.5-2 hours of constant cleaning.

Noise Level: Some robot vacuum moppers can be noisy, which might be an issue if you plan to utilize them throughout the day. Look for models with quiet operation.

Smart Home Integration: If you have a smart home ecosystem, consider a robot vacuum mopper that incorporates seamlessly with your existing devices.

Upkeep and Cleaning: Regular maintenance is vital to keep your robot vacuum mopper working optimally. Inspect the ease of cleaning the filters, brushes, and water tanks.

Cost: Robot vacuum moppers can vary considerably in cost. While more expensive models typically include advanced functions, it's crucial to find a balance in between cost and functionality that fits your budget.
Frequently Asked Questions About Robot Vacuum Moppers
1. How do robot vacuum moppers work?Robot vacuum moppers utilize a combination of sensing units and navigation algorithms to map and clean your home. They vacuum and mop floors utilizing a water management system that controls moisture, making sure that the floor is cleaned without being over-soaked.

2. Can robot vacuum moppers clean carpets?While many robot vacuum moppers are created for tough floorings, some designs can deal with low-pile carpets. It's crucial to examine the specs to make sure the gadget appropriates for your particular floor type.

3. How typically should I use a robot vacuum mopper?The frequency of usage depends on your home needs. For homes with pets or high foot traffic, everyday cleaning is often suggested. For others, a couple of times a week might suffice.

4. Are robot vacuum moppers easy to maintain?Most models are developed to be user-friendly, but regular upkeep is needed. This consists of clearing the dustbin, cleaning the filters, and filling up the water tank. Some designs also require periodic brush replacements.

5. Can I control a robot vacuum mopper with my mobile phone?Yes, many robot vacuum moppers come with mobile apps that allow you to manage and arrange cleaning sessions, check the cleaning map, and receive alerts.

6. How do I ensure the robot vacuum mopper doesn't get stuck?To prevent the robot from getting stuck, keep the floor clear of loose items, cords, and small barriers. Some models also have features that help them navigate challenging areas.

7. Are robot vacuum moppers suitable for homes with family pets?Yes, robot vacuum moppers are excellent for homes with animals as they can efficiently get rid of pet hair, dander, and other particles. Nevertheless, guarantee that the design you pick has strong suction and a robust purification system.

8. What is the lifespan of a robot vacuum mopper?The life expectancy can differ, but with proper maintenance, the majority of robot vacuum moppers can last 2-5 years. Some high-end models can last longer.
